#  Estimated Flood Inundation Area  

 



   ![Map of Baton Rouge city and parish with lines marking large areas of flooding throughout the city](/sites/g/files/omnuum10826/files/styles/hwp_1_1__960x960_scale/public/datasmart/files/baton_rouge_flooding_2016.png?itok=TFkf1hY4) 

 

In 2016 Baton Rouge was hit with a terrible storm that led to extreme flooding, severe property damage, and several deaths. In order to understand what areas of the city-parish were worst hit, where to direct overburdened resources, and how to navigate through the storm debris. This map and data collection work sparked a broader conversation about utilizing maps for environment risks and infrastructure planning and safety at the city-parish level, and is still used today.



 

##  Stats 

Dataset(s); 911 and 311 calls, Baton Rouge Fire Department search and rescue data, in-person notes on damage assessments, debris collection routes, road closure information, NOAA imagery, Civil Air Patrol imagery, FEMA DFIRM flood hazard, and comments/photos of damage from the public.

Visualization: Map

Jurisdiction: City-Parish of Baton Rouge

Developed by: Baton Rouge Department of Information Services
